Vanguard Long-Term Corporate Bond ETF (VCLT) pays monthly dividends, with an annual dividend of $4.08 per share and a dividend yield of 5.64%. Investors who owned the stock before the ex-dividend date of Monday, August 3, 2026 received the most recent monthly payment of $0.3502 per share, paid on Wednesday, August 5, 2026.
